In a lucky turn of events, I was contracted by National
Geographic and Lindblad as a cultural specialist for Colombia on
their recent expeditions from Cartagena to Panama and back.
Hugging the Caribbean coastline, our journey departed from
Cartagena before taking in Santa Cruz del Islote, Isla Tintipan,
Tuchin, the Bahia de Cispata, Santa Cruz de Lorica before finishing
the Colombian leg with a visit to Capurgana and Sapzurro.
In Panama, we stopped by the Kuna Yala islands, Portobelo, the
final resting place of Sir Francis Drake before heading up to the
Panama Canal to cross from the Caribbean to the Pacific and managed
to squeeze in some birdwatching in Gatun Lake.
